ZIP code 93530 covers Keeler, California.

Time zone
Pacific UTC-08:00observes daylight saving time

Where 93530 is

Keeler, California — the area the Census Bureau draws for this ZIP code. ZIP codes are sets of delivery routes rather than areas, so this is the Census approximation of one, not a Postal Service boundary.
